About The Position

This internship is based in Santa Clara, California and offers a unique opportunity for students passionate about electrical engineering design, development, and integration into medical robotics. Electrical engineering interns will work alongside other engineering domains such as mechanical, mechatronics, controls, software, and clinical engineering. This will support the prototyping, development, test, and production of surgical robotic platforms that will improve patient outcomes worldwide. As an Electrical Engineering Intern, you will design, prototype, test and integrate multi-layer PCBA's for use in a complex medical device system. You will work with across engineering functions to make contributions in the fields of robotics, surgical instruments, and more. This role offers a high degree of autonomy and opportunities for project growth within the team as we progress towards realizing our vision.

Responsibilities

  • Develop and prototype PCAs (PCBAs) for implementation in robotic elements, subsystems and testing fixtures.
  • Deliver documentation to support designs of PCAs in medical devices such as technical reviews, engineering studies, test results, and architecture documents.
  • Work alongside senior engineers and mentors to develop reliable designs for various robotic tasks.
  • Test, debug, and perform root cause analysis of issues identified during bench testing and system integration.
  • Generate and present design concepts, perform design reviews to team members.
  • Participate in clinical assessments of robotic devices in inanimate anatomical models.
